Missing a deadline can cost your chance at funding. Always apply early to avoid last-minute issues.
| Scholarship Type | Deadline |
|---|---|
| Holland Scholarship | May 1st |
| Saxion Talent Scholarship | May 1st |
| Orange Tulip Scholarship | Country-specific |
| Saxion Excellent Scholarship | July 1st |
